OPINION

PER CURIAM:

Respondent was charged with embezzlement, a felony under NRS 205.300. A motion to suppress evidence was granted by the district court, and the state has appealed. Respondent has filed a motion to dismiss the appeal. Respondent contends, among other things, that the order granting the motion to suppress evidence is not an appealable order. We agree.
